Chris H. Gardner

Chris H. Gardner, MAAP
Vice President
Programs and Member Services
Automotive Aftermarket Suppliers Association (AASA)

Chris Gardner is responsible for managing the association’s events, including AAPEX activities, AASA Executive Breakfast and AASA member-only Vision Conference. He also manages the Fuel Pump Manufacturers Council and the MEMA Technology Council as well as all technology and data initiatives. He has served on several industry technology organizations.

Gardner was the vice president of marketing for Management Information Systems Group, Inc., the former e-commerce commercial division of MEMA. His previous experience includes managing an office for Eisbrenner Public Relations, a public relations agency that focuses on the automotive supplier community, editor-in-chief of an automotive trade magazine and as a product engineer with tier one supplier Collins & Aikman. Gardner earned a B.S. degree from North Carolina State University.
